A globally accessible city is well connected with the surrounding world via high-quality, high-capacity and reliable transport and communication infrastructure. The term "global" refers to the need to connect Brno with the metropolises located in (Central) European and global space (such as Prague, Vienna, Bratislava, Munich, Berlin, etc.) and also includes a reference to hierarchically superior transport and communication routes (such as air routes, motorways, high-speed lines, global data networks, etc.).
Good accessibility of the city and its metropolitan region is important for an efficient and reliable functioning of all components of its life, especially for the metropolitan economy, scientific structures, and for all other socio-economic activities, as it allows maintaining and developing the necessary contacts. Its expression is the easy reach of the city and its surroundings for all people arriving here or departing from here (residents, commuters, investors, entrepreneurs, tourists, scientists and others).
